New Book from Dorian Vallejo



Open Palette Press has just released the first book devoted to the art of New Jersey portraitist, Dorian Vallejo. Titled, Drawings: Inspired by Life, this 192 page volume offers a variety of life drawings created by Vallejo "solely for the pleasure of creative research and the visual expression of ideas." Though inspired by the academic drawings created by artists more than a century ago, Vallejo's drawings are far from academic in execution: rather, they are studies in form, mood, tone, and the beauty of a quickly-realized, figural representation.
